Abstract
This article aims to investigate the effect of material surface stress on the propagation of Love waves in a rotating, homogeneous, initially stressed orthotropic elastic solid with impedance-type boundary conditions. For deriving Love waves, the basic equations are solved with the help of the traditional wave solution method. Secular equations about Love waves are computed as a function of surface stress, rotation, and initial stress. The effects of initial compression and surface stress have been discussed numerically using MATLAB for a particular model.
